Understanding Window SealsWhat Are Window Seals?
Window seals are the barriers between the window frame and the glass. They are created to prevent air and moisture from getting in or exiting a structure, making sure that the indoor environment remains comfy and energy-efficient. The most common type of window seals are found in double-glazed or triple-glazed windows, which use several panes of glass filled with argon gas for insulation.
Importance of Window Seals
Maintaining effective window seals is crucial since:
Energy Efficiency: Seals assist preserve the wanted temperature level in an area, decreasing heating & cooling costs.Moisture Protection: Proper seals avoid water seepage, which can result in mold growth and structural damage.Noise Reduction: Effective seals assist minimize outside noise, enhancing overall comfort.Indications of Window Seal Damage
Recognizing the indications of a harmed window seal is critical for a prompt repair. Here are some typical indications:
Condensation: Moisture accumulation between panes of glass signifies a seal failure.Drafts: Feelings of cold air coming through the window show a compromised seal.Foggy or Cloudy Glass: Visual distortion is typically a result of moisture getting trapped.Noticeable Gaps or Cracks: An evaluation might reveal gaps in the caulking or weather condition stripping around the window.Repairing Window SealsWhen to Repair vs. Replace
Before diving into repairs, house owners should examine whether it's more affordable to repair or replace the windows. Small seal failures can often be fixed, while considerable damage might require full window replacement.
Typical Repair Techniques
Here are the primary approaches for repairing window seals:
DIY Caulking:
Materials: Caulk, caulking weapon, putty knife.Process:Remove old or broken caulk with a putty knife.Tidy the location thoroughly to remove particles.Use brand-new caulk evenly around the edges, making sure a tight seal.
Defogging Methods:
Materials: Dehumidifier or glass sealant.Process:For small fogging, use a dehumidifier to reduce humidity levels indoors.Additionally, particular glass sealants can be applied to help clear fogged windows.
Professional Repair:
If DIY approaches stop working or if the damage is extreme, working with a professional is advised.Specialists may utilize sophisticated methods such as vacuum sealing or argon gas re-injection.Cost of Window Seal Repair
The cost of repairing window seals varies based on elements such as the degree of the damage, window type, and labor costs. Here's a general breakdown:
ServiceEstimated CostDo it yourself Caulking₤ 5 - ₤ 20 (products only)Defogging Services₤ 60 - ₤ 125 per windowProfessional Replacement₤ 200 - ₤ 800 per windowAvoidance Tips
Regular maintenance can avoid window seal concerns. Here are some avoidance ideas:
Inspect Regularly: Check your windows a minimum of twice a year for signs of damage.Clean the Caulking: Regularly clean and examine the caulk surrounding your windows.Use Weather Stripping: Consider using weather condition stripping to more seal windows throughout severe weather condition.FAQs About Window Seal RepairWhat triggers window seals to stop working?
Window seals can fail due to age, extreme temperature changes, incorrect setup, and ecological factors such as moisture and UV direct exposure.
Can window seals be repaired without replacing the window?
Yes, minor damages can frequently be fixed utilizing caulking or de-fogging approaches. However, more major concerns may need professional intervention or complete window replacement.
How long do window seals generally last?
The majority of window seals last in between 10 to 20 years, depending upon the quality of materials used and environmental conditions.
Is it worth repairing window seals?
Repairs can conserve cash compared to changing entire windows. In addition, fixed seals help preserve energy efficiency, improve comfort, and avoid future damage.
How can I tell if my window seals require to be replaced?
If numerous windows show indications of seal failure, such as considerable condensation or fogginess, it may be more economical to change the windows completely.
